Founded in 2022, RVO Health is a new healthcare platform of digital media brands, services and technologies focused on building relationships with people throughout their health & wellness journey. We meet people where they are in their personal health journeys and connect them with both the information and the care they need. RVO Health was created by joining teams from both Red Ventures and UnitedHealth Group’s Optum Health. Together we’re focused on delivering on our vision of a stronger and healthier world.
RVO Health is comprised of Healthline Media (Healthline, Medical News Today, Psych Central, Greatist and Bezzy), Healthgrades, FindCare and PlateJoy; Optum Perks, Optum Store and the virtual coaching platforms Real Appeal, Wellness Coaching, and QuitForLife.

At RVO Health, our mission is to give people a better way to health & wellbeing. We own and operate the largest health & wellbeing platform in the US, helping nearly 100 million people a month seek information, find a doctor, save money, and take action around their health & wellbeing. Our portfolio of industry-leading websites, products and services touches every part of the health and wellness journey. The Healthline Group portfolio (Healthline, Medical News Today, Psych Central, Greatist, and Bezzy) and the Healthgrades brand comprise the largest health information audience in the US. The Healthline Group connects millions of people daily to medically-backed information about thousands of health-related questions, products, and chronic conditions. Through Healthgrades, the largest marketplace for finding healthcare, we help half of Americans find and evaluate a doctor each year. Through Optum Store, we sell thousands of FSA/HSA-eligible health and wellness products direct-to-consumer and connect health seekers to mental health, condition-based virtual care, and an online pharmacy. Through Optum Perks, we help millions of people save money through our prescription savings program. Millions of health seekers also use RVO Health’s virtual coaching programs each year to lose weight, stop smoking, and find better wellbeing. Our portfolio includes education and advice, condition-based communities, access to healthcare, an ecommerce store of health products and services, prescription discounts and delivery, and more. We are making health easier to navigate, more accessible, and more affordable for everyone. Furthermore, all of our content, products, and services are medically-backed, so people can trust that they are getting accurate support for their health. RVO Health is backed by Red Ventures and Optum, part of UnitedHealth Group. Select brands previously operated by Red Ventures and Optum are now independently operated by RVO Health.
